Output 66db3a5a0759ac8bb58c90314729e8615874717401506e66489a1b0ba051f33e:0

value
83876957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 161d78689c2f904e1ebf6e4c6899fe624944bc0c OP_EQUALVERIFY OP_CHECKSIG
address
131wArdzCeGZXwQYT2dwocrnHv386mR1Yk
transaction
66db3a5a0759ac8bb58c90314729e8615874717401506e66489a1b0ba051f33e
spent
true